QUESTION: my pregnant bunny gave birth last night to one baby bunny, but the baby was dead when we found him, is it possible that she will give birth again. if so, when?

ANSWER: Hi Cait

Usually when they have babies they have them all at once.  On a very rare occasion they can be pregnant in both uterine horns and another baby or 2 can be born but it is usually within 12 hours of each other.

QUESTION: dear pam, i am pretty sure my rabbit is in labor again, she looks like shes having a really hard time. she is panting hard, her back end is somewhat wet. she has kept her legs open from the time i first saw her. she doesnt seem to know what to do, she keeps moving around from place to place, her back end out. im really nervous! HELP!

Answer
Hi Cait

If it has been this long she probably has a kit stuck.  The very best thing you can do for her is to get her to a vet immediately.  They can give her pitocin that can help produce stronger contractions and help get the baby out.  In worse case scenario they may have to do a C-section.  Occasionally kits will get a condition where they grow to large and the doe will be unable to deliver them.  It is very possible that the doe can die from this condition without immediate care from a veterinarian.

Please take her to the nearest 24 hour animal hospital.  If you don't know where there is an animal hospital in your area that treats rabbits please check out this site it may be helpful:

http://www.rabbit.org/vets/vets.html

If you can't find anything there then immediately start looking through your phone book and calling any veterinarian you can find.  Look for one that treats exotic pets.  They should have answering services.  If they don't treat rabbits they should be able to refer you to the nearest place that does.  Remember that exotic animal veterinarians are not as common as small animal veterinarians so it may be a 2 or 3 hour drive so its imperative that you go immediately.
